Output 5996ab6ddb1451530383e2128afcfc817ae77eebad4c9bef85fa4a1ff66b91f4:2

value
145340000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b904e6b50f93b0b077288e6899bfeb3c5448182a OP_EQUAL
address
3JZJoaELS9nQiTp766sAsjdpH1StKd3QMk
transaction
5996ab6ddb1451530383e2128afcfc817ae77eebad4c9bef85fa4a1ff66b91f4
spent
true